The BCI Asia Awards is one of the most recognized authoritative certifications in the Asian construction industry, aimed at commending contractors for their significant contributions to the local construction industry and providing professional recognition. CR Construction has won the "Top 10 Contractors 2024" award in this year's BCI Asia Awards.